Data cables are marked with tape.
Ribbon cables are marked with either labels or tape.
Customer-specific (engineered) wiring (option +P902) is not marked.

Bottom cable entry/exit (options +H350 and +H352)
For UL Listed (+C129) units, the default input and output cabling direction is through the
roof of the cabinet. The bottom entry (+H350) and bottom exit (+H352) options provide
power and control cable entries at the floor of the cabinet. The entries are equipped with
grommets and 360° grounding hardware.
For non-UL Listed units, bottom entry/exit is the default cabling arrangement.
Top cable entry/exit (options +H351 and +H353)
The top entry (+H351) and top exit (+H353) options provide power and control cable entries
at the roof of the cabinet. The entries are equipped with grommets and 360° grounding
hardware.
Cable conduit entry (option +H358)
The option provides US/UK conduit plates (plain 3 mm thick steel plates without any
ready-made holes).
Additional terminal block X504 (option +L504)
The standard terminal blocks of the drive control unit are wired to the additional terminal
block at the factory for customer control wiring. The terminals are spring loaded.
